I'm sorry to hear about your situation. Testing positive after a trip can be really stressful, especially when it comes to managing accommodations and flights. When I was in a similar situation, I found that reaching out to my airline and hotel directly was helpful—they were often more flexible than expected. For travel insurance, make sure to document everything, from your test results to any communication with service providers. It might take some time, but persistence pays off.
